Synopsis

Filmmaker Werner Herzog combs through the film archives of volcanologists Katia and Maurice Krafft to create a film that celebrates their legacy.

AI Analysis

The film's strength lies in its subversion of mid-20th-century scientific hierarchies. By centering Katia Krafft's agency, the documentary disrupts the trope of the female assistant, instead presenting a partnership of intellectual parity. However, the film lacks intentionality regarding racial and LGBTQ+ intersectionality. While the setting is global, local populations are treated as background elements rather than individuals with narrative depth. Ultimately, the work provides a sophisticated, secular perspective on the human condition, though its narrow biographical focus limits its broader social representation.
